After landing in Kolkata, airline ‘forgets’ elderly blind flyer in plane

IndiaTimes Monday, 4 September 2023
A Glasgow-based fashion designer with roots in Kolkata slammed a private airline on Sunday for allegedly leaving his wheelchair-bound, blind, elderly mother on an empty plane when it landed at Kolkata from Delhi on August 31. The fashion designer opted for an assisted travel plan for his mother, which means she was to be assisted throughout her journey.
